Three-Cheese Homemade Stuffed Shells
Three-Cheese Homemade Stuffed Shells are a comforting and hearty dish that is perfect for family dinners or a cozy weeknight meal. These pasta shells are generously filled with a creamy blend of cheeses, creating a delightful flavor profile that appeals to both children and adults. The use of three different cheeses—ricotta, mozzarella, and parmesan—adds depth and richness to each bite, making it a standout choice for any occasion. Whether you’re hosting a gathering or simply enjoying a quiet evening at home, these stuffed shells are sure to impress. They’re not only delicious but also easy to prepare, making them an excellent option for those who want to enjoy a homemade meal without spending all day in the kitchen.
Why You’ll Love This Recipe?
There are several compelling reasons to enjoy Three-Cheese Homemade Stuffed Shells. First and foremost, the flavor combination of the three cheeses creates a creamy and satisfying filling that melts in your mouth. The contrast of textures between the soft pasta shell and the rich cheese filling adds an extra dimension to the dish. Secondly, this recipe is incredibly easy to make, making it accessible for cooks of all skill levels. The preparation involves simply mixing the cheese filling, stuffing the shells, and baking them in a flavorful marinara sauce. This straightforward method means you can have a delicious meal ready in no time. Furthermore, Three-Cheese Homemade Stuffed Shells are highly versatile; you can customize the recipe by adding vegetables or herbs to the cheese filling, enhancing both the flavor and nutritional value. This adaptability allows you to experiment and create variations that cater to your family’s preferences. Lastly, these stuffed shells make for excellent leftovers, retaining their delicious flavor and texture when reheated, making them a practical choice for busy weeknights.
Ingredients to make The recipe :
To create the perfect Three-Cheese Homemade Stuffed Shells, gather the following ingredients:
- Large Pasta Shells: You will need about 20-24 large pasta shells, which are designed to hold the cheese filling perfectly. These shells are typically made from durum wheat and provide a sturdy base that holds up well during baking. Cook them al dente according to the package instructions, ensuring they remain firm enough to be stuffed without tearing.
- Ricotta Cheese: Approximately 1 ½ cups of ricotta cheese is essential for the filling. This creamy cheese adds a smooth texture and mild flavor that balances the other cheeses. Ricotta is also high in protein, making it a nutritious addition to the dish.
- Shredded Mozzarella Cheese: Use 1 cup of shredded mozzarella cheese for a gooey, melty component in the filling. Mozzarella is known for its stretchiness, which enhances the overall mouthfeel of the stuffed shells. It also browns beautifully when baked, adding a lovely visual appeal.
- Grated Parmesan Cheese: About ½ cup of grated Parmesan cheese is necessary for adding a sharp, salty flavor to the filling. Parmesan not only enriches the taste but also contributes to a golden-brown crust on the top layer when baked.
- Marinara Sauce: You will need approximately 2 cups of marinara sauce to pour over the stuffed shells before baking. This sauce adds moisture and flavor, helping to meld all the ingredients together while providing a delicious contrast to the rich cheese filling.
- Fresh Basil: A handful of fresh basil leaves, chopped, can be mixed into the cheese filling or used as a garnish. Basil offers a fragrant herbal note that brightens the dish and complements the richness of the cheeses.
- Salt and Pepper: Use salt and pepper to taste in the cheese mixture. These seasonings enhance the flavors and ensure that the filling is well-balanced.
- Olive Oil: A drizzle of olive oil can be added to the marinara sauce or used to grease the baking dish. This oil adds a lovely richness and helps prevent sticking.
How to Make Three-Cheese Homemade Stuffed Shells ?
Making Three-Cheese Homemade Stuffed Shells is both fun and rewarding. Follow these detailed steps for a delicious outcome:
- Begin by preheating your oven to 375°F (190°C). This temperature ensures that the shells bake evenly and the cheese filling becomes bubbly and delicious.
- Next, bring a large pot of salted water to a boil. Once boiling, carefully add the large pasta shells and cook them for about 8-10 minutes, or until al dente. Stir occasionally to prevent sticking. Once cooked, drain the shells and rinse them under cold water. This will stop the cooking process and help them cool down for easy handling.
- While the shells are cooking, you can prepare the cheese filling. In a large mixing bowl, combine the ricotta cheese, shredded mozzarella cheese, grated Parmesan cheese, and chopped fresh basil. Use a spatula or a wooden spoon to mix the ingredients thoroughly until they are well combined and creamy.
- Season the cheese mixture with salt and pepper to taste. It’s essential to taste as you go to ensure that the filling is well-seasoned and flavorful. Adjust the seasoning according to your preference.
- Once the filling is ready and the shells have cooled, it’s time to stuff the shells. Take one shell at a time and use a spoon to fill each shell with the cheese mixture. Be generous, but avoid overstuffing, as they need to fit snugly in the baking dish.
- As you fill each shell, arrange them in a greased baking dish, preferably a 9×13-inch dish. Pour half of the marinara sauce evenly across the bottom of the dish to create a moisture layer for the shells.
- After filling the shells and arranging them in the dish, pour the remaining marinara sauce over the top of the stuffed shells. Ensure that all the shells are covered with sauce to prevent them from drying out during baking.
- Cover the baking dish with aluminum foil to keep the moisture in while the shells bake. Place the dish in the preheated oven and bake for 25 minutes. This initial baking time allows the flavors to meld and the cheese to become warm and gooey.
- After 25 minutes, carefully remove the foil from the baking dish. This step is crucial for allowing the top layer of cheese to brown and become slightly crispy. Return the dish to the oven and bake for an additional 10-15 minutes, or until the cheese is bubbling and golden.
- Once the Three-Cheese Homemade Stuffed Shells are perfectly baked, remove them from the oven and let them cool for about 5 minutes. This cooling time makes it easier to serve and helps the filling set.
- Garnish with additional fresh basil if desired, and serve warm. Enjoy your homemade stuffed shells with fresh salad or garlic bread for a complete meal.
Tips for Variations:
Consider these creative variations of Three-Cheese Homemade Stuffed Shells to elevate your dish:
- For a protein-packed option, add cooked ground chicken or turkey to the cheese mixture. This addition not only enhances the flavor but also makes the dish more filling, perfect for hearty appetites.
- Add finely chopped spinach or kale to the cheese filling for a boost of nutrients. These greens integrate well with the cheese and add a vibrant color to your stuffed shells.
- Incorporate sun-dried tomatoes into the cheese mixture for a tangy twist. Their concentrated flavor complements the creamy cheeses, creating a delightful contrast that enhances the overall dish.
- For a spicy kick, consider adding red pepper flakes or diced jalapeños to the cheese filling. This variation will appeal to those who enjoy a bit of heat in their meals.
- Experiment with different types of cheese; for instance, try incorporating feta cheese for a Mediterranean flair or gouda for a smoky flavor. Each cheese brings its unique character to the dish, allowing for endless possibilities.
- For a lighter version, use whole wheat or gluten-free pasta shells. This substitution maintains the integrity of the dish while catering to dietary preferences.
- Try adding a layer of roasted vegetables, such as zucchini or bell peppers, beneath the stuffed shells in the baking dish. This not only adds flavor but also increases the nutritional value of the meal.
- For a creamy sauce alternative, mix a little cream cheese with the ricotta for an ultra-rich filling. This variation is especially indulgent and perfect for special occasions.
- Top the stuffed shells with a sprinkle of breadcrumbs mixed with olive oil before baking for a crunchy topping. This addition adds texture and contrasts beautifully with the creamy filling.
- Lastly, consider pairing your stuffed shells with a homemade pesto sauce instead of marinara for a fresh and herbaceous flavor profile that will surprise your guests.
Serving Suggestions:
When it comes to serving Three-Cheese Homemade Stuffed Shells, there are numerous options to enhance the dining experience:
- Serve the stuffed shells hot from the oven, garnished with fresh basil and a sprinkle of grated Parmesan cheese. This presentation adds both flavor and visual appeal to the dish.
- Pair the stuffed shells with a crisp green salad dressed lightly with olive oil and lemon juice. The freshness of the salad balances the richness of the cheese-filled pasta.
- Consider accompanying the dish with garlic bread or cheesy breadsticks. These sides are perfect for scooping up any extra marinara sauce, making for a satisfying meal.
- For special occasions like Ramadan or family gatherings, consider serving with a side of roasted vegetables or a seasonal vegetable medley to complement the flavors of the stuffed shells.
- Leftovers can be stored in an airtight container in the refrigerator for up to three days. Reheat in the oven or microwave until warmed through, perfect for a quick lunch or dinner option.
- For a festive touch, serve the stuffed shells alongside a variety of Italian antipasti, such as olives, marinated artichokes, and bruschetta, allowing guests to create their own Italian-inspired plates.
- As a meal prep option, consider assembling the stuffed shells in advance and freezing them before baking. This method allows for quick meals on busy nights, simply bake them directly from the freezer.
- In terms of seasonal pairings, Three-Cheese Homemade Stuffed Shells can be particularly delightful in the fall or winter, accompanied by a warm loaf of bread and a hearty vegetable soup.
- Lastly, for a cozy dinner, serve the stuffed shells with a side of your favorite Italian dessert, such as tiramisu or panna cotta, to complete the meal on a sweet note.
FAQ:
How do I store leftovers?
Store any leftover Three-Cheese Homemade Stuffed Shells in an airtight container in the refrigerator. They can last up to three days. Reheat in the oven at 350°F (175°C) until warmed through for the best texture.
Can I freeze this recipe?
Yes, you can freeze Three-Cheese Homemade Stuffed Shells before baking. Assemble them in a freezer-safe dish, cover tightly with plastic wrap, and then with foil. They can be frozen for up to three months. Bake directly from frozen, adding extra baking time.
Can I make the filling ahead of time?
Absolutely! You can prepare the cheese filling for Three-Cheese Homemade Stuffed Shells a day in advance. Simply store it in the refrigerator until you’re ready to stuff the shells.
What type of marinara sauce should I use?
You can use store-bought marinara sauce or make your own from scratch. For Three-Cheese Homemade Stuffed Shells, a simple tomato-based sauce works best, enhancing the flavors of the cheese filling.
Are Three-Cheese Homemade Stuffed Shells suitable for meal prepping?
Yes! Three-Cheese Homemade Stuffed Shells are excellent for meal prepping. You can assemble them ahead of time, store them in the fridge, or freeze them for quick meals later in the week.

Three-Cheese Homemade Stuffed Shells
Equipment
- Large Pot
- Mixing Bowl
- Baking Dish
- Spatula
Ingredients
Pasta Shells
- 20-24 pieces Large Pasta Shells Cooked al dente according to package instructions.
Cheese Filling
- 1.5 cups Ricotta Cheese Provides a creamy texture.
- 1 cup Shredded Mozzarella Cheese Adds gooey texture when melted.
- 0.5 cup Grated Parmesan Cheese Adds sharp flavor and helps with browning.
Sauce
- 2 cups Marinara Sauce To pour over the stuffed shells.
Seasoning
- 1 handful Fresh Basil Chopped, for flavor and garnish.
- to taste Salt
- to taste Pepper
- 1 tablespoon Olive Oil For greasing the baking dish.
Instructions
- Preheat your oven to 375°F (190°C).
- Bring a large pot of salted water to a boil and cook the pasta shells for 8-10 minutes until al dente. Drain and rinse under cold water.
- In a large mixing bowl, combine ricotta, mozzarella, parmesan, and basil. Mix until creamy.
- Season the cheese mixture with salt and pepper to taste.
- Stuff each shell with the cheese mixture and arrange them in a greased baking dish.
- Pour half of the marinara sauce over the bottom of the dish, then place the stuffed shells on top. Pour the remaining sauce over the shells.
- Cover with aluminum foil and bake for 25 minutes.
- Remove the foil and bake for an additional 10-15 minutes until the cheese is bubbling and golden.
- Let cool for 5 minutes before serving. Garnish with additional basil if desired.